How To Fix CNV20551860 - Plant &1 is not relevant, but assigned Maint. Planning Plant &2 is relv.


CNV20551860 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CNV20551 - message for package 20551 (company code delete)

  • Message number: 860

  • Message text: Plant &1 is not relevant, but assigned Maint. Planning Plant &2 is relv.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The Plant is not deletion relevant, but its assigned Maintenance
    Planning Plant, is deletion relevant. The assignment can be checked SPRO
    > Enterprise Structure > Assignment > Plant Maintenance > Assign
    maintenance planning plant to maintenance plant.

    System Response

    If you proceed with the current settings, post deletion, you would have
    inconsistencies in the assigned plant, as its Maintenance Planning Plant
    will not exist. You will not be able to remove the assignment through
    SPRO. You would get the error that the Planning Plant is not defined.

    How to fix this error?

    Evaluate the cross plant assignment, i.e. the assignment of Maintenance
    Planning Plant, from a different company code, which is being deleted.

CNV20551860 - Details

  • The SAP error message CNV20551860 indicates that there is a mismatch between the plant assignment and the maintenance planning plant in your SAP system. Specifically, it suggests that the plant you are trying to work with (Plant &1) is not relevant for the operation you are attempting to perform, while the assigned maintenance planning plant (Plant &2) is relevant.
    
    Cause: Plant Relevance: The plant you are trying to use may not be set up correctly in the system for the specific operation or transaction you are attempting to execute.
    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the system that determine which plants are relevant for maintenance planning, and Plant &1 may not be included in those settings. Data Migration Issues: If this error occurs during a data migration process, it could be due to incorrect mappings or settings in the migration tool.
